Why silver darkens?

The wines of the whole hydrogen sulfide, which is formed during the contact of silver products with the environment. So, for example, the color change leads:

• Wet air;

• touch (due to sweat, skin fat, remnants of cosmetics, etc.);

• use of dishwashing agents;

• Interaction with food.

How to clean silver at home?

The easiest way to return the brilliance of silver instruments is to take advantage of the special cleaning agent for products from this type of metal. It can be in the form of a liquid for soaking or in the form of a cleaning paste. Apply them worth in accordance with the instructions specified on the package.

In addition, housewives for more than five centuries of the use of cutle silver were able to come up with a lot of silver variants in the proper look. All of them do not require expensive ingredients and are available to most people.

So, here are the most popular Homemade table silver cleaning:

- Soda.

Mix soda with water to consistency thick casher. Apply it on a soft cloth, and then sweeten spoons, forks and knives.

- Salt.

Prepare the salty solution by taking 25 grams of the table salt and 10 grams of potassium salt of wicked acid (wine stone) and half a liter of hot water. Put the cutlery for up to 20 minutes into the liquid.

- Lemon acid.

Take 100 grams of citric acid and half a liter of water, mix, add a piece of copper wire and bring to a boil in a water bath. Then put in a saucepan of silver and hold there 15 minutes.

- Summer alcohol.

In the case of a small darkening, it is enough to wipe cutlery with a cotton disk, impregnated with the ammonia.

In more launched situations, a mixture consisting of five teaspoons of water, two teaspoons of the ammonia and one - toothpaste. This composition will need to grasp silver and leave for 15 minutes.

- Vinegar

Wipe with a cloth moistened with vinegar, enough to remove a thin bloom.

It's important to know: After any type of cleaning, be it a factory or home recipe, the devices need to rinse in warm water and wipe dry. If necessary, you can complete the cleaning of silver by polishing with a special napkin.

How can not clean silver?

In no case cannot be used to clean the silver abrasive agents intended for cleaning shells, kitchen stoves, dishes, as well as rigid brushes. They can scratch metal, because of which he will forever lose his gloss. In addition, the dirt will be stuck in the recesses, and in the future, cleaning will become even more difficult.

It's important to know: Silver cutlery can not be washed in dishwashers. This may apply them irreparable harm.

How to store silver?

You can slow down the darkening, storing cutlery strictly in closed boxes. With these separators between spoons, forks and knives should not be made of rubber: it will lead to the opposite effect.
